Determine whether the planes are parallel, perpendicular or neither. 4x − 3y + 2z = 5, x + 6y + 7z = 3

4x − 3y + 2z = 5 ... (P)
x + 6y + 7z = 3 ..... (Q)
the perpendicular vector to the (P) is : v(4,-3,2)
the perpendicular vector to the (Q) is : l(1,6,7)
v ⊥ l because : (4)(1)+(-3)(6)+(2)(7= =0
so : (P) ⊥ (Q)
